Definition ∞ Ledger serialization is the process of converting the structured data of a distributed ledger, such as transaction records or account states, into a format suitable for storage, transmission, or cryptographic hashing. This conversion ensures that data can be consistently represented and interpreted across all nodes in a network, which is vital for maintaining consensus and ledger integrity. Proper serialization is essential for verifying cryptographic proofs and ensuring the immutability of historical records. It facilitates efficient and reliable data exchange within and between blockchain systems.
Context ∞ The topic of ledger serialization often arises in crypto news when discussing the technical underpinnings of blockchain interoperability or the efficiency of data processing. A key discussion involves the choice of serialization formats, such as JSON, Protocol Buffers, or custom binary formats, and their impact on network performance and compatibility. Future developments include the adoption of more standardized and optimized serialization methods to enhance cross-chain communication and streamline data handling in complex decentralized environments.